2011-11-08 70 views
0

我發現現在很多書和教程都在教如何編寫GUI應用程序,但我想寫一個老式的學校控制檯應用程序。但我不知道如何開始。例如,我不知道如何在控制檯應用程序中編寫框架,如何在控制檯應用程序中監聽事件。如何使用Py3k編寫控制檯應用程序?

是否所有的用戶界面都使用print()來「繪製」UI?或者有一種工具可以這樣做?另外,如何移動光標位置?最後但並非最不重要的是,如何聆聽關鍵用戶的輸入?謝謝。

+0

一個控制檯應用程序通常只使用標準輸入/輸出。你所說的更具體是TUI的。 http://en.wikipedia.org/wiki/Text_user_interface調用它「控制檯」可能沒有錯,但沒有具體說明。 –

回答

4

我自己並沒有使用它,但curses應該是一個很好的起點。

它是「用於便攜式終端先進處理事實上的標準」

相關問題